    Since you are using a glass bed try using magigoo glue stick. Your prints stick and when cooled down to room temp they pop off with little effort. Or use a spring steel PEI flex sheet. I really like mine. Very little problems and if the prints stick too much, just flex the sheet slightly and it come right off.

      This bed has a layer of adhesive on it that only gets tack when heated. Never really have an issue popping prints off the bed with a beveled edged scraper. The ones I ordered to test were not beveled and too thin.
